Human Resource Planning Process
• Definition : Strategy for the acquisition, utilization
and retention of an enterprise’s human resources.

• Stages of HRP :
 Investigation
Forecasting
Planning & Control
of Manpower
Utilization
Human Resource Planning Process
• Investigation

– This would determine the manpower requirements for


the business development.
– Manpower requirements can be
figured by SWOT analysis of the
organization.
• External Environments
• Performance
• Profitability
Human Resource Planning Process
• Forecasting
– Here Demand Analysis and Manpower supply is initiated.
– Demand forecasting helps in identifying requirements of
manpower for
various positions at different
points of time.
– Main aim of forecasting is to
determine the number and
type of employees needed in the future.
Human Resource Planning Process
• Planning & Control of Manpower
– This involves developing plans to modify your business
plans and work accordingly to meet the ever growing
needs and challenges of the industry and the market.
– Recruitment &
Training & Development.
– Recruitment : Job Description,
Job Roles.
– Training & Development : Knowledge
& Skill Development
Human Resource Planning Process
• Utilization
– Here , success is measured in terms of
achievement trend, both quantitatively and
qualitatively.
– Quantitative achievement : Productive Trends,
Manpower Costs.
– Qualitative Achievement :
Achievement of Organizational
Objectives.

Training & Development
Functionality
• Training is a process whereby an individual
acquires job-related skills and knowledge.

• The main benefits of training are


improved productivity and motivation
of staff and also better quality
products being made.
Different Stages In Training
• Induction / Orientation
Introduce new employees to the business.

Overview to the organization


Overview to the processes

Provide employees with better


knowledge about the business
and the market it operates in.
Different Stages In Training
• Pre-Process Training
– Voice N Accent (VNA)
• Pronunciation
• Tips to improve your pronunciation
–  Observe the mouth movements of those who speak English well and try
to imitate them.
– Listen to the 'music' of English.
– Make a list of frequently used words
that you find difficult to pronounce
and ask someone who speaks the
language well to pronounce them
for you.
– Record your own voice and listen for pronunciation mistakes.
Different Stages In Training
• Pre-Process Training
– Voice N Accent (VNA)
• Liaisons
– Words are not pronounced one by one. Usually, the end of
one word attaches to the beginning of the next word. This is
also true for initials, numbers, and spelling.

Spelling Pronunciation
LA [eh lay]
909-5068 [nai nou nain, fai vo sick
sate]

Different Stages In Training
• Pre-Process Training
– Voice N Accent (VNA)
• Practice words list
– The American T
» The American T is influenced very strongly by intonation
and its position in a word or phrase. 
» Attorney Time Trigger Ten
– The American R
» The American R is like a vowel because it does not touch
anywhere in the mouth. The American R is produced
deep in the throat.
» Mother Father Number More
Different Stages In Training
• Pre-Process Training
– Voice N Accent (VNA)
• Practice words list
– The American L
» The American L has two different pronunciations in English, In the
beginning or middle of a word, the tongue tip touches just behind
the teeth and L at the end of a word. Because in this case the letter
L has a shorter, sharper pronunciation
» Yourself Tell Level love Girl
– Words with ‘AU’ sound
» Our Country Account
– Words with ‘A’ sound
» After Transfer Pass

Call Center a Highly Monotonous
Job
• Dealing with phone calls one after other without
enough breaks, leads the employees towards a
mechanical mode of working. This kind of work
environment is a perfect breeding place for stress.
• Adding to the monotonous job situation,
employees also have to face
the brunt of arrogant and
rude callers.

Workers Participation
Management (WPM)
• Meaning
– WPM is a system where workers and management
share important information with each other and
participate in decision making. It is viewed as industrial
democracy based on the principal of equity, equality
and volunteerism.
It gives right to worker’s
representatives to criticize and
offer constructive suggestions
for better management.
Workers Participation
Management (WPM)
• Benefits to the Organization

– Increases motivation
– Rapport between top management and bottom
line
– Efficiency increases.
– Implementation becomes easier
